Facilitating A Thriving Community of Practice for Teachers
This workshop will focus on helping teacher leaders initiate and cultivate successful communities of practice in their schools and organizations.
At the end of the workshop, teachers will be able to (1) Understand the key principles in facilitating and creating thriving communities of practice (2) Apply insights on adult learning theory and latest research on lifelong learning in planning out an effective continuing professional development initiative in one’s context (3) Design ground rules to cultivate a more harmonious and collaborative community of practice in one’s context (4) Facilitate learning sessions for teachers to reflect on and deepen their motivations and mindsets in the teaching practice in relation to their professional identity, and apply insights learned from discussions
